Ricoh 5510nf Questions...
Ok so our office is getting this all in one printer, fax, copier.....and we want to automate a process.
What they do now....is they receive a fax....they scan it....then they add it to into our physician software. What we want to do is cut out the scanning part. Is there any software available or anything which when the fax comes in...it will be scanned automatically into a location that the person will not have to actually go an rescan the document after it is received. So we're trying to cut out the middle process i guess...the scanning part, because that takes up the most time for people in the department. Any suggestions???
